Aaminah is an Arabic name meaning "safe, secure, or trustworthy," rooted in the same triliteral root as *amin* (faithful). It is best known as the name of Aaminah bint Wahb, the mother of the Prophet Muhammad, giving it profound significance in Islamic tradition. While the spelling Aaminah is less common in Scotland than the variant Amina, it has appeared consistently among the country's baby names since the 1970s, reflecting Scotland's diverse cultural landscape. The name shares its root with the word *amen* used in prayer across faiths, creating a gentle echo of trust and protection.
